Job Summary

" Support daily technology operations of the client's collaboration center, a 17,000 sq. ft. collaboration space with 8 experiential rooms.

" Manage and maintain all technology, including software upgrades, hardware implementation, VR/AR usage, AI integration, and pilot testing for new technologies.

" Lead the technology operating model, ensuring seamless execution of collaboration sessions and tech-driven init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

" Define, implement, maintain, and troubleshoot all technology within the DCC.

" Oversee software installs, system upgrades, firewall patches, and hardware management.

" Manage VR/AR integration, AI execution, and tech pilot testing.

" Lead project management for all tech-driven initiatives, ensuring timely execution.

" Assess and develop supplier relationships for enhanced tech services.

" Manage the server room and oversee all technology and devices in the space.

" Provide on-site support for modular technology, furniture setup, and demos.

" Assist guests with technology challenges and troubleshoot issues during collaboration workshops.

" Work closely with senior leaders, industry experts, and top customers to ensure a seamless experience.

" Run the DCC independently when needed, maintaining a professional and service-oriented approach.

Required Qualifications

" Minimum 3 years of experience in a corporate environment.

" Strong technical skills with a focus on troubleshooting (50% of the role).

" Proven project management skills, including planning, execution, and timeline management.

" Excellent communication skills (both written and verbal).

" Ability to work independently and interact professionally with senior stakeholders.
